Andrew Broccoli

BIOGRAPHY

After completing a business degree, he worked for 5 years then joined Bombardier in 1999 where he worked for 8 years. During his tenure at Bombardier, Andrew was involved in many projects including pricing of the Global XRS & G5000. He was also the finance manager to engineering and production departments where he acquired knowledge of the aviation industry. He moved on to be a production delivery manager for Bombardier Global aircraft where his main duties were to ensure production activities were completed on time in addition to assuring the highest level of quality. He was also responsible for the completion centers mobile repair team (MRP), where he assured the complete customer satisfaction away from the completion centre. In 2007 Andrew was made the director of completion at a consulting firm in Montréal. In that capacity, he was responsible for the inspection of aircrafts from pre-completion through to pre-purchase. In addition, he implemented and managed the completion management process for a multitude of satellite stations. Over the past twenty years, Andrew has been directly involved with over one hundred and fifty completions and deliveries.

PHIL TARDIF

BIOGRAPHY

He began his career in 1990 in the air force reserve. After graduating as an aircraft maintenance engineer in 1993, He worked with an organization that performed heavy maintenance on piston engine aircraft, turbo propeller aircraft and Bell Helicopter products, where he obtained his transport Canada certification as a license maintenance engineer. In 1998, he joined the Bombardier Global Completion Center as a lead technician in the pre-flight department; he was responsible for the aircraft from the green stage through to the aircraft delivery, always ensuring all conformities were met. This also involved daily interaction with customers to update them of the aircraft progress while maintaining customer satisfaction. He went on to work for several different organizations where he gained extensive maintenance experience as well as type courses on Bombardier CRJ 100-200-850, the Global platform, Boeing 737 600-700-800 (BBJ), Boeing 757-767, Airbus 319-320 as well as Bell Helicopters. He has been working as a customer representative since 2007 where he has carried out multiple pre-buy inspections, green aircraft inspections, aircraft maintenance oversight, completion and delivery management.
